Carl Ralph Hutson, age 95, passed away on Wednesday, November 29, 2017 at Merit Health Gilmore Memorial Hospital in Amory, Mississippi.
He was born on November 6, 1922 in Itawamba County to Alver Elvin Hutson and Willie Lee Foster Hutson. He married Dorothy Wilson on September 5, 1943 and they were married for 72 years. He farmed until he and Dorothy moved to Zion, Illinois in 1950. He was a retiree of Nosco Printing Company of Waukegan, Illinois.
He and Dorothy became members of Grace Missionary Church in Zion, Illinois in 1966 where Rev. Clinton Bell was their pastor. He retired in 1992 and he and his wife Dorothy (affectionately known to him as Dottie) moved back to Mississippi and made Liberty Grove Baptist Church their home church. As long as his health permitted, he enjoyed raising cattle, keeping the lawn looking neat, growing a garden, and caring for his cats. He also enjoyed collecting and playing his fiddles.
